Job Responsibilities:
• Assembling, Installing, Operation, Maintenance and Checking Microwave Antennas as per requirements.
• Commissioning of the site as per the transmission design.
• Mapping and Aligning of the microwave antennas as per the given RSL (radio signal level) in the design.
• Conducting the PAT (preliminary acceptance test) and handing over the site to the customer with in the proposed
duration.
• Checking and Correcting Faults Microwave Antennas, ODU & IDU.
• Rectification of the site down complaints due to the failure of microwave links, power failure, BTS complaints etc.
• Conducting RF Surveying for 3G Sites of Mobily.
Job Responsibilities:
• Team Leadership for the site installation and Co-ordination with the costumers.
• Co-ordination with the costumer about site implementation planning etc.
• Measurement of Voltage Standing Wave Ratio (VSWR), Distance - To - Fault (DTF) and Return Loss of RF feeder,
Jumpers and connectors using Site Master (ANRITSU).
• Checking the quality of the sites.
• Getting acceptance done for the Site(s).
• New site survey according to nominal plan to decide the most appropriate site location, Site Auditing for existing sites
to verify site database and cell design criteria’s (checking Azimuths, Mechanical & Electrical tilts, Panoramic views
etc).
• Preliminary Acceptance Test of the site & handover of the site without any oils to the Operator.
• RF survey for design purpose of GSM-900 and RBS-1800 cell site and Microwave Linking by using the Global
Mapper.
• Conducting Radio Network design (RND) taking the Latitudes and Longitudes of three positions.

• Digital Communications
o Summary: To calculate the probability of symbol error over fading channels. Fading is caused due to the
interference between two or more versions of the transmitted signal which arrive at the receiver at slight different
times. In this project the significance of the alternate representation of Q-function in evaluating Average
Probability of Symbol Error over a fading channel was done and the theoretical derivations were supported using
MATLAB simulations for M PAM & M QAM modulation schemes (such as Rayleigh and Nakagami).
• Stochastic Processes
o Summary: Applications of CHI-SQUARE Random Variables and SINR. GPS has been widely used in studying of
the phenomena of Sudden Increase of Total Electron Content (SITEC) caused by the solar flare. To illustrate this
we construct the Independent Identical Gauss Distribution (IIDN(0,1)) and then hypothesis testing of the chi-
square is then involved in analyzing the time series of TEC so that the anomaly can be checked out.
